Rajasthan ·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 2018
Jitendra Singh of Indian National Congress won the Khetri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Rajasthan in the 2018 state assembly election, securing 57,153 votes (37.70% vote share). The runner-up was Dharmpal (Bharatiya Janata Party) with 56,196 votes.
A total of 11 candidates contested this assembly seat. | Position | Candidate Name | Votes | Votes% | Party |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Jitendra Singh | 57153 | 37.70% | Indian National Congress |
| 2 | Dharmpal | 56196 | 37.00% | Bharatiya Janata Party |
| 3 | Pooranmal Saini | 35166 | 23.20% | Bahujan Samaj Party |
| 4 | Amar Singh | 1314 | 0.90% | Rashtriya Loktantrik Party |
| 5 | Rishal Singh | 610 | 0.40% | Independent |
| 6 | Rajesh | 507 | 0.30% | Independent |
| 7 | Tarachand | 178 | 0.10% | Bharat Vahini Party |
| 8 | Bajrang | 171 | 0.10% | Independent |
| 9 | Umrao Singh Kadyan | 165 | 0.10% | Aam Aadmi Party |
| 10 | Priyanka | 154 | 0.10% | Abhinav Rajasthan Party |
| 11 | Ramswroop | 149 | 0.10% | Bharatiya Yuva Shakti |
